Kinds Of Italian Driving Licenses
Italy problems several categories of driving licenses based on vehicle type. Each category enables the holder to run specific classes of vehicles. Below is an overview of the primary driving license classifications in Italy:
License CategoryCar TypeMinimum AgeAMotorbikes (with or without a sidecar)24 years or 20 years (if finishing a two-year training period)BCars and light vehicles (approximately 3.5 tons)18 yearsCTrucks (over 3.5 lots)21 yearsDBuses and vehicles developed to carry more than 8 travelers24 yearsETrailers (needs appropriate license classification)Dependent on base car category
Note: Certain categories likewise have subcategories (e.g., A1 for light motorbikes), which can be acquired at lower minimum ages.
How to Obtain an Italian Driving License
Getting an Italian driving license includes several steps, whether for Italian citizens or citizens with a foreign license. The steps consist of:

Meet Eligibility Requirements
Be of the required minimum age for the wanted license category.Hold a valid identification document (e.g., passport, ID card).
Acquire a Medical Certificate
Pass a medical evaluation to guarantee physical and mental physical fitness for driving. This certificate is typically provided by a qualified medical professional.
Enlist in a Driving School
While self-study is possible, enrolling in a certified driving school is a good idea. They will offer theoretical guideline, practical driving lessons, and help in preparations for examinations.
Theory Test
Pass a composed theory test that covers traffic laws, safety rules, and general driving knowledge.
Driving Test
Successfully finish a practical driving test to demonstrate your capability to operate a vehicle safely.
Get the License

For expatriates or tourists wishing to drive in Italy, understanding the conversion of foreign driving licenses is crucial. The following details the general process and requirements for converting a foreign driving license to an Italian one:

Eligibility
Foreign licenses stand for as much as one year from the time of residency in Italy. After one year, conversion is essential to continue driving legally.
Paperwork Required for Conversion

Application Process
Submit the needed files at the regional Motorizzazione Civile (Motor Vehicle Department).Pay applicable charges.If essential, take the theory and/or practical tests.
Caveats

How long does it require to get an Italian driving license?The process can take anywhere from a few weeks to numerous months, depending upon the applicant’s readiness for the theory and driving tests and the offered times for scheduling these tests. 2. Can I drive in Italy with a foreign license?Yes, foreign licenses stand for as much as one year if you are a local. For tourists, foreign licenses are typically accepted briefly. It is best to carry an International Driving Permit(IDP)along with your foreign license. 3. Is a medical examination compulsory to get an Italian driving license?Yes, a medical exam is required to obtain a medical certificate confirming your fitness to drive. 4. Are driving schools obligatory for acquiring a license?While not lawfully needed, registering in a driving school is highly advised as it guarantees proper training and preparation for the tests. 5.
